1

Sod installation

News Discuss 
A vibrant, green lawn is a hallmark of a well-maintained property, and sod installation is one of the fastest ways to achieve it. Whether you're refreshing an existing yard or starting from scratch, laying sod can transform your outdoor space almost overnight. https://texasgardenmaterials.com/landscape-design-houston-tx/sod-installation-delivery-houston-tx/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story